You're on Candid Camera
The Wisconsin State Assembly on Wednesday passed Senate Bill (SB) 247, outlining uses of surveillance systems, including cameras, during the sale of property.
Rep. Allen introduces bill expanding rights for virtual students
Representative Scott Allen (R-Waukesha) along with Senator Jerry Petrowski (R-Marathon) introduced legislation enabling students enrolled in virtual charter schools to participate in extracurricular activities, including interscholastic athletics, in their resident school districts.
